What a Widebody Kit Does to the Chevrolet Corvette C6

Few modifications change a Chevrolet Corvette C6 as completely as a widebody conversion. Extended flares push each side out by 30–80mm, which opens room for genuinely wider wheels and gives the Corvette C6 the planted, arch-filled silhouette the widebody scene is built around. Done properly, the result reads as if the factory shipped it that way — the flares belong to the body rather than sitting on top of it, and the car looks different from every angle you walk around it.

Corvette C6 Widebody Kit: The Cost Breakdown

Budget a well-executed Corvette C6 widebody build at $6,000–$20,000+ on enthusiast platforms with premium kit options all-in, and work backwards from there. The kit itself is only part of that: entry-level FRP parts start around $1,500–$3,000, established names like Liberty Walk, Rocket Bunny, and Pandem sit in the $3,000–$8,000 band, and carbon fibre or custom fabrication can reach $12,000–$20,000 before anything is fitted. The remaining $2,500–$5,000 goes on the work that makes or breaks the result — installation, body prep, gap filling, and paint.

Corvette C6 Widebody Kit: Common Questions

Does a widebody kit hurt the resale value of a Corvette C6?

It narrows the buyer pool rather than simply lowering the price. A widebody Corvette C6 appeals strongly to enthusiasts and weakly to everyone else, so it can take longer to sell and the modification rarely returns its full cost. If resale flexibility matters, factor that in before cutting fenders — the conversion is not practically reversible.

FRP or carbon fiber for a Corvette C6 widebody kit?

FRP (fiberglass-reinforced plastic) is the accessible route — entry kits start around $1,500–$3,000, and the material takes paint well but needs careful prep and fitting. Carbon fiber kits and high-end fabrication run $12,000–$20,000 before installation, trading cost for weight savings and finish. For most street builds on a Corvette C6, a well-fitted FRP kit painted properly is the sensible choice; carbon belongs on builds where budget follows ambition.

How long does a widebody install take on a Corvette C6?

Plan for a multi-week shop job, not a weekend. The kit itself arrives fast — it's the test fitting, fender modification, gap filling, body prep, and paint that dominate the timeline, and rushing any of those stages is what separates a factory-looking result from an obvious bolt-on. Ask your shop for their timeline before committing.
